Best Images of the Advanced Observing Program


The Advanced Observing Program is an experience available to the public at the Kitt Peak Visitor Center. With no technical knowledge needed, guests are able to take extremely high-quality CCD images using our 20in RC Optical Systems, Meade Lx200 and 76mm TeleVue (APO) refractor Visitor Center Telescopes.

The gallery archived here is a snapshot of the image collection Adam Block worked on with guest observers until Septemeber 2005. These public JPEGS and captions are a mirror image of the Advanced Observing Program offered at Kitt Peak. The gallery there will continue to evolve- this gallery can be used as a reference and resource for information on several hundreds of objects.
